| int udev_node_mknod(struct udevice *udev, const char *file, dev_t devt, mode_t mode, uid_t uid, gid_t gid) |
| { |
| struct stat stats; |
| int retval = 0; |
| |
| if (major(devt) != 0 && strcmp(udev->dev->subsystem, "block") == 0) |
| mode |= S_IFBLK; |
| else |
| mode |= S_IFCHR; |
| |
| if (stat(file, &stats) != 0) |
| goto create; |
| |
| /* preserve node with already correct numbers, to prevent changing the inode number */ |
| if ((stats.st_mode & S_IFMT) == (mode & S_IFMT) && (stats.st_rdev == devt)) { |
| info("preserve file '%s', because it has correct dev_t", file); |
| selinux_setfilecon(file, udev->dev->kernel_name, stats.st_mode); |
| goto perms; |
| } |
| |
| if (unlink(file) != 0) |
| err("unlink(%s) failed: %s", file, strerror(errno)); |
| else |
| dbg("already present file '%s' unlinked", file); |
| |
| create: |
| selinux_setfscreatecon(file, udev->dev->kernel_name, mode); |
| retval = mknod(file, mode, devt); |
| selinux_resetfscreatecon(); |
| if (retval != 0) { |
| err("mknod(%s, %#o, %u, %u) failed: %s", |
| file, mode, major(devt), minor(devt), strerror(errno)); |
| goto exit; |
| } |
| |
| perms: |
| dbg("chmod(%s, %#o)", file, mode); |
| if (chmod(file, mode) != 0) { |
| err("chmod(%s, %#o) failed: %s", file, mode, strerror(errno)); |
| goto exit; |
| } |
| |
| if (uid != 0 || gid != 0) { |
| dbg("chown(%s, %u, %u)", file, uid, gid); |
| if (chown(file, uid, gid) != 0) { |
| err("chown(%s, %u, %u) failed: %s", |
| file, uid, gid, strerror(errno)); |
| goto exit; |
| } |
| } |
| |
| exit: |
| return retval; |
| } |
